Add support for HmIPW-DRBL4 in homematicip_cloud (#148844)

This commit is contained in:
hahn-th
2025-07-16 08:10:56 +02:00
committed by GitHub
parent 2011e64390
commit 9c933ef01f

View File

@@ -12,6 +12,7 @@ from homematicip.device import (
FullFlushShutter, FullFlushShutter,
GarageDoorModuleTormatic, GarageDoorModuleTormatic,
HoermannDrivesModule, HoermannDrivesModule,
WiredDinRailBlind4,
) )
from homematicip.group import ExtendedLinkedShutterGroup from homematicip.group import ExtendedLinkedShutterGroup
@@ -48,7 +49,7 @@ async def async_setup_entry(
for device in hap.home.devices: for device in hap.home.devices:
if isinstance(device, BlindModule): if isinstance(device, BlindModule):
entities.append(HomematicipBlindModule(hap, device)) entities.append(HomematicipBlindModule(hap, device))
elif isinstance(device, DinRailBlind4): elif isinstance(device, (DinRailBlind4, WiredDinRailBlind4)):
entities.extend( entities.extend(
HomematicipMultiCoverSlats(hap, device, channel=channel) HomematicipMultiCoverSlats(hap, device, channel=channel)
for channel in range(1, 5) for channel in range(1, 5)